1. Regulatory and Permitting Complexity

Georgia enforces tight restrictions on vehicle size, weight, and route usage. Even a small mistake in permit paperwork or load dimensions can delay a shipment or lead to fines.

How we handle it:

  • We handle all permitting through the Georgia Department of Transportation (GDOT).
  • Our team ensures compliance for single-trip, annual, and superload permits.
  • You stay focused on your project — we take care of paperwork, approvals, and regulations.

2. Infrastructure and Route Restrictions

Georgia’s road system is a mix of aging infrastructure, tight city areas, and unpredictable construction zones. A clear path on a map doesn’t always mean a safe or legal route for a heavy haul load.

How we handle it:

  • Every route is custom-planned based on bridge weight limits, height clearances, and turning radii.
  • We monitor construction schedules, traffic updates, and detour options in real time.
  • For urban hauls, we plan off-peak timing to avoid delays in areas like Atlanta or Macon.

3. Geographic and Environmental Conditions

From mountain regions to flood-prone areas, Georgia’s geography presents a wide range of challenges for heavy haul transport.

How we handle it:

  • We use specialized trailers, additional axles, and push trucks to manage steep grades or soft terrain.
  • Routes are adjusted based on weather forecasts to avoid storms and road closures.
  • Your freight is secured and prepped for the specific terrain it will cross.

4. Urban and Rural Traffic Patterns

A 120-foot load can’t move like a regular trailer — especially through tight city streets or narrow rural roads.

How we handle it:

  • We coordinate pilot cars, law enforcement escorts, and access timing for both urban and rural hauls.
  • Our team works with local municipalities to ensure legal movement through all jurisdictions.
  • Freedom Heavy Haul minimizes disruption by planning moves during off-peak hours and in coordination with local traffic control.

5. Load Security and Safety Compliance

Georgia has frequent inspection stations and zero tolerance for unsecured or unbalanced freight. Any issue can lead to your shipment being held up or turned around.

How we handle it:

  • All freight is secured with heavy-duty chains, edge protection, and industry-best balancing methods.
  • We conduct thorough pre-trip and mid-trip inspections to ensure nothing shifts or loosens during transport.
  • If your shipment is stopped, it passes inspection — that’s our responsibility.

6. Equipment and Maintenance Demands

Oversized loads require the right equipment in top working condition. Delays due to equipment failure are unacceptable.

How we handle it:

  • We operate a modern fleet of lowboys, RGNs, stretch trailers, and multi-axle platforms.
  • Every unit undergoes rigorous maintenance and inspection before deployment.
  • If an issue arises, our mobile repair teams respond immediately — reducing downtime and avoiding delays.

7. Coordination with State and Local Authorities

Whether it’s the Port of Savannah or a rural substation, local authorities often have their own rules for heavy haul transport.

How we handle it:

  • We file travel notices, coordinate escorts, and manage communication with all relevant agencies.
  • Our operations team ensures all municipal and county-level rules are met.
  • You don’t chase paperwork or permissions — we do it all before your load moves.

FAQs About Heavy Haul Trucking Challenges in Georgia

Here are some questions and answers:

What permits are required for oversized loads in Georgia?
Georgia requires single-trip, annual, or superload permits based on your load’s size and weight. Freedom Heavy Haul handles all permitting for you.

How long does it take to get a heavy haul permit in Georgia?
Standard permits can be issued in 1–3 business days. Superloads may take longer depending on the route and load specifics.

Can heavy haul loads move through Atlanta?
Yes, but movement is restricted during peak traffic hours. We schedule city hauls during off-peak times and coordinate with local authorities.

What equipment is best for heavy haul in Georgia?
It depends on the load, but we commonly use lowboys, RGNs, and multi-axle trailers based on weight distribution and route conditions.

Is an escort vehicle required in Georgia for oversized freight?
Escort requirements depend on the size and route. We handle all escort coordination — including police escorts when needed.
